BRASS TENNIS BALL SCULPTURE WITH PLINTH, 1960s

 
This brass tennis ball sculpture from the 1960s combines fine craftsmanship with the playful charm of MidCentury design. Made from heavy, hollow brass and enriched by a naturally developed patina, it features a realistic tennis ball rendered in true to size proportions, giving the piece a distinctive and slightly whimsical presence. Its weight and solid construction make it an eyecatching object for any desk, while its unusual form also serves as a decorative statement piece. A small sculpture with big personality, it sparks curiosity, brings a smile, and often invites spontaneous admiration. Whether displayed as a charming highlight on a desk, as a decorative accent on a shelf, or as part of a Mid Century collection, this brass tennis ball adds character and authentic vintage charm to any interior. A wonderful find for collectors and lovers of original design objects.
